Transaction 068e26ee9407fcf84f8639bb4573f6226e46e5f63e82ebff5be4c12328d34d49

2 Input
1 Outputs
  • 068e26ee9407fcf84f8639bb4573f6226e46e5f63e82ebff5be4c12328d34d49:0
  • value  525519
    address  3JruLrAbDyfXVcYAy6KR5yEBkDAALDme7Q